Output 6f5e3d973eb273978757679067c6f9f9d3a4947171fa5e2a8f77af2cbebd7377:68

value
7961415
script pubkey
OP_0 OP_PUSHBYTES_20 ffdab5e156682db4001d5aa4fc13225524c23fe6
address
bc1qlldttc2kdqkmgqqat2j0cyez25jvy0lxefncca
transaction
6f5e3d973eb273978757679067c6f9f9d3a4947171fa5e2a8f77af2cbebd7377
confirmations
134003
spent
true